Infertility, IVF & The Pro-Life Ethic | Stephanie Gray Connors, Speaker & Author | Episode 148

Women are amazing — their bodies can literally grow new people! But for a woman who wants to be a mother but experiences fertility troubles, it can feel like her body is at war with her heart. Science offers a whole host of "assisted reproductive technologies" in these cases, but not all of them are life-affirming choices. And there are many options that are ethical and effective but not widely advertised.

In this episode, pro-life speaker and author Stephanie Gray Connors will take us through the pro-life positions on In Vitro Fertilization (IVF) and other a range of other medical options for fertility and women's health. Gray provides tools to help determine whether a fertility treatment is ethically problematic, and how to engage loved ones in discussing this intriguing but sometimes emotional topic.
